Well I have been sober for 55 days now, and feel pretty good. I am thrilled with my new sober life. I am losing weight, and just feel all around healthier.

I do have issues with anxiety, I would consider myself a bit of a hypochondriac. I have worried over the past year or so about my health and what my drinking may have done to it. Well, I finally went to the doctor on Friday and told them about my drinking and that I had quit almost 2 months ago. Their initial examination was fine, but of course they are running a CBC to check and make sure liver, kidneys etc. are all working fine.

I am so afraid of what they are going to say...I should find out tomorrow, but really nervous right now:-(

Dolly,
You did a good thing going to the doc to get checked out. I understand the anxiety. I had a lot of it in early recovery. I'm still in early recovery actually, but around the 70-80 days mark, the anxiety lessened. I have little panics now, usually when I do something sober for the first time, or when I'll be away from home for a while. But I manage through it just fine now. You'll feel better after you hear back from doctor. Whatever the results, you are repairing your body and mind now, so you will continue to heal! That's a good thing to remember!

Tell the Doctor about your anxiety. You might need something for that and you may have been self medicating with the booze. I have an Anxiety Disorder, and I tend to drink it away, unfortunately it comes back with a vengeance, I'm on anti anxiety meds, but they don't work so well if you're drinking with them.
